Latest web development tutorials

Metoda jQuery find ()

Metody traversal jQuery Metody traversal jQuery

Przykłady

Powrót <ul> potomstwo wszystkie <span> Element:

$(document).ready(function(){
$("ul").find("span").css({"color":"red","border":"2px solid red"});
});

wyniki:

body (great-grandparent)
div (grandparent)
    ul (parent)
  • li (child) span (grandchild)

Spróbuj »

Definicja i Wykorzystanie

find () Metoda zwraca wybrane elementy podrzędne elementu.

Potomkiem jest dzieckiem, wnukiem, prawnuki, i tak dalej.

DOM drzewa: Ta metoda jest przesuwany w dół wzdłuż potomnych elementów DOM, wszystkie ścieżki aż do ostatniego potomka (<html>). Podobnie jak przechodzenie drzewa DOM dół pojedynczej hierarchii (powrót bezpośredni element podrzędny), użyć () dzieci metodą.

Uwaga: Parametry filtra w sposób znaleźć () jest to wymagane, która różni się od innych sposobów przechodzenie drzewa.

Wskazówka: Aby przywrócić wszystkie potomków elementów, użyj "*" selektor.


gramatyka

$(selector).find( filter )

参数 描述
filter 必需。过滤搜索后代条件的选择器表达式、元素或 jQuery 对象。

注意:如需返回多个后代,请使用逗号分隔每个表达式。

Przykłady

Więcej przykładów

Powrót <html> wszystkie elementy podrzędne
Użyj wybieraka "*", aby powrócić <html> wszystkie elementy podrzędne.

Powrót <ul> potomstwo wszystkie <span> Element
Jak Powrót <ul> potomstwo wszystkie <span> Element.

Wybierz potomstwo o danej nazwie klasy
Jak zwrócić elementy potomkiem klasy o nazwie "1".

Zwracać wiele potomstwo
Jak zwracać wiele elementów potomnych.

KRYTERIA przez jQuery zbiór wszystkich pokoleń <ul> Element
Jak Powrót <ul> element z jQuery obiektu potomka wszystkie <span> elementu.

Przedstawienie przez potomków nazwy znacznika elementu
Demo <div> potomkami elementu.


Metody traversal jQuery Metody traversal jQuery